Virginia governor proposes making Juneteenth a paid state holiday after chat with Pharrell Williams

Published June 16, 2020 7:51pm ET



Virginia Gov. Ralph Northam proposed declaring Juneteenth a paid state holiday.

The Democrat made the announcement Tuesday, standing alongside Pharrell Williams, a Virginia native.
